No time to waste the beauty.

August 7, Point Place.

Researching the mayflies on the web I learned that they only live a day, for the sole purpose of mating and passing on their genes.
That makes their beauty even more poignant, if a little wasteful.

The day's magnificence.

August 7, Point Place.

We had breakfast at the Mongodal down the street this morning, as always on this lot, and Dylan and I became engrossed in mayflies, their ethereal, intricate structure, the breathtaking beauty of their perfectly adapted beings, hanging all over the store’s windows like tiny party balloons for evolution’s magnificent daily display.
